Trias Blackwind is a clever bard who enjoys embellishing his achievements and telling tales of grandeur to his fellow students at Argent University.
In the race for the chancellorship, Trias can recruit young, impressionable mages to join his side, allowing him to take more actions than other candidates. First appeared in Argent: The Consortium as a backer-created character, Trias is included in Trials of Indines as a fully-fledged BattleCon character.

Story[]
Trias hails from the Southeastern continent of Amalao , a land of elementals, dryads, beastfolk, and other legends. Growing up on a beachfront village, he learned much about sailing, travel, and faraway lands. As a boy he sat in the taverns and listened to the stories the sailors would tell, dreaming of having a legend of his own one day. As a teenager, he left home to seek his fortune in the world.
After countless adventures, Trias appeared again, having discovered a mystical instrument within which was trapped his own ancestor, Blackwind , an elemental who had opposed the dragons in their ancient war a millennium ago. By enrolling in Argent , he is seeking to uncover the power of his own latent elemental heritage as well as discover a way to break the draconic curse on the cithara and set his ancestor free.

Game appearances and playstyle[]
Argent: The Consortium[]
As a neutral candidate, Trias has a larger pool of neutral mages and starts with a Merit Badge, allowing him access to improved locations.
Trias has a set of Embellishment Cards which he may ante for additional effects and power, at the cost of priority. These cycle with his attack pairs and return to hand with them. He primarily functions as a fairly mobile ranger with a decent ability to create distance between himself and his opponent, with his Embellishments adding flexibility to his kit.

Character Kit in BattleCon[]
Unique Abilities[]
Ability Name | Character Version | Description |
---|---|---|
Embellish | Original | Trias has 6 Embellishment Cards: 3 Start and 3 End. He begins the Duel with all of them.
During the Ante Step, Trias may embellish his Attack pair by anteing up to 1 Start and/or 1 End Embellish Card face-down. On Reveal, their effects are added to his attack. Any anted Embellishments cycle with his current Attack Pair. If Trias antes one Embellishment, he has -1 Priority this Beat. If he antes two Embellishments, he has -3 Priority this Beat. |

Embellishments[]
Name | Type | Effect |
---|---|---|
Super | Start | +2 Power |
Truly | Start | Soak 1, Stun Guard 2 |
Perfectly | Start | -1~+1 Range |
Of The Ages! | End | On Hit: Push the opponent 1 space and they must discard a base of their choice with their current Attack Pair. |
From The Heavens! | End | End of Beat: Move up to X spaces, where X is the amount of damage you took this Beat. |
With Style! | End | You cannot be moved by opponents this Beat. |
